Behind responsive support is a structure that makes sure problems are captured, tracked, and actually resolved rather than forgotten. The IT support Allentown businesses depend on runs on a proper helpdesk: a single place to report issues, a ticketing system that records each problem so nothing slips through the cracks, and a troubleshooting process that works methodically toward a fix. When you report an issue, it becomes a tracked ticket rather than a vague request that might be lost in someone's inbox, which means every problem has an owner and a status until it is closed. Troubleshooting is where experience pays off, because resolving a technology problem quickly depends on recognizing what is actually wrong rather than guessing. Skilled support narrows down the cause efficiently, applies the right fix, and confirms the problem is truly solved instead of merely papered over. The ticketing structure also means that if a problem recurs, there is a record of what happened before, making the next resolution faster. This combination of an organized helpdesk and capable troubleshooting is what turns a chaotic scramble during a breakdown into a calm, reliable process that consistently gets people back to work.
Technology problems come in many forms, and good support meets them wherever they happen, whether that means fixing an issue remotely in minutes or coming to the office when a problem demands hands on the hardware. The IT support Allentown owners value covers both, because the right response depends on the problem. A great many issues can be resolved remotely, with a support technician connecting to a system to diagnose and fix it quickly without anyone having to wait for a visit, which is often the fastest path back to working. Other problems, like failed hardware, network equipment that needs attention, or a setup that has to be done in person, call for onsite support where someone physically comes to handle it. Having both options available means a business is never stuck because a problem happens to be the kind that cannot be fixed over a connection. The everyday problems that interrupt work, from a single user who cannot get into a system to an issue affecting the whole office, get the response they need in the way that resolves them fastest. Flexible, responsive help that comes to you when it must and reaches you instantly when it can is what keeps everyday breakdowns from becoming lost days.
